The Art of Team-Based AI Onboarding
The implementation of AI across Scania is not a mere software update; it’s a cultural shift. The company has devised **team-based onboarding** strategies that ease the workforce into AI adoption. This involves hands-on training sessions where employees work collaboratively to learn about **AI systems**, fostering an ecosystem of continuous learning and adaptation. Implementing Strong Guardrails
As AI becomes more integrated into daily operations, it is crucial to establish **strong guardrails**—guidelines and protocols that assure ethical and effective AI usage. For Scania, these guardrails act as a safety net, mitigating risks associated with data privacy and algorithmic bias. The goal is to enable an innovative yet secure environment where AI can thrive without compromising on data security or integrity.
